What is california department of corporations-stipulation?
The California Department of Corporations-Stipulation is a legal agreement or settlement between the California Department of Corporations and a party, typically a business entity or individual, that has been found to have violated regulatory laws or engaged in improper business practices.
Who is required to file california department of corporations-stipulation?
The party that has been found to have violated regulatory laws or engaged in improper business practices is required to file the California Department of Corporations-Stipulation.
How to fill out california department of corporations-stipulation?
The California Department of Corporations-Stipulation is typically filled out by the party that has been found to have violated regulatory laws or engaged in improper business practices. The specific process may differ depending on the circumstances and requirements set forth by the department.
What is the purpose of california department of corporations-stipulation?
The purpose of the California Department of Corporations-Stipulation is to resolve regulatory violations or improper business practices by outlining agreed-upon terms and conditions for compliance. It serves as a legal document that defines the actions and obligations of the responsible party moving forward.
What information must be reported on california department of corporations-stipulation?
The specific information required to be reported on the California Department of Corporations-Stipulation may vary depending on the nature of the regulatory violations or improper business practices. Generally, it may include details about the violations, corrective actions to be taken, timelines for compliance, and any financial penalties or restitution that may be levied.
